About

Mary Milne, a glass artist, works in both stained glass and warm (kiln formed) glass producing her work in her studio in Springs, NY. She has studied glass art at Pratt Institute and Urban Glass in Brooklyn as well as Bullseye Glass and has been actively involved in the medium for the past ten years, producing both landscapes and abstract designs. Her work is both two dimensional and sculpted.

After first trying her hand at stained glass at Pratt, she moved into working in kiln formed glass at Urban Glass. She has studied under Ann Hayes, Erica Rosenfeld, George Thomas, Moshe Bursuker and Miriam De Fiori of Italy. 

Mary has exhibited at the Lehman Gallery, Bridgehampton Historical Society, Studio East, Barnes Gallery in Garden City, Fiedler Gallery in Greenport, Kramoris Gallery in Sag Harbor, East End Art juried shows, Peconic Land Trust and Nature Conservancy Landscape shows, Artist Alliance of East Hampton shows, as well as various group shows in the Hamptons.  Mary has held studio tours of her home studio in East Hampton to benefit Guild Hall as well as the Artist Alliance of East Hampton studio tours. She has been chosen as a finalist in the MTA Arts in Transit competition. 

Mary is a member of the board of the Artists Alliance of East Hampton.
